Management Commentary

During the accompanying earnings call, Brazil’s leadership focused heavily on operational milestones achieved during the previous quarter, rather than the expected quarterly loss. Management noted that the negative EPS for the period is entirely attributable to planned spending on engineering design, environmental baseline data collection, stakeholder engagement, and pre-construction site preparation for its potash asset. Leadership confirmed that all spending during the quarter remained within previously approved budget parameters, with no unplanned cost overruns recorded. Management also highlighted positive feedback from regulatory authorities during the quarter regarding the firm’s environmental and social impact filings, a key step in the process of securing final operating permits for the mine. They emphasized that the project is positioned to address a critical gap in the Brazilian agricultural supply chain, as domestic farmers currently rely heavily on imported potash to support crop yields, exposing them to global commodity price volatility and supply chain disruptions. Forward Guidance

In its forward-looking commentary shared alongside the the previous quarter results, GRO’s leadership noted that the company expects to continue recording operating losses over the upcoming months, as it advances permitting and pre-construction work for its mining facility. No specific revenue guidance was provided, consistent with the pre-production stage of the project, as the timeline for final regulatory approval and subsequent commercial production remains subject to external review processes. Management did confirm that the firm has sufficient cash reserves on hand to cover all planned operational and capital expenditures for the next several quarters, eliminating near-term liquidity risks for the project. Leadership added that it will provide regular updates on permitting progress and construction timelines as key milestones are reached.
